This seems to have happened to Meredith after installing the AAM mod for Misty of all things.
EDIT: Never mind, found the source of the problem. Get rid of basegame_AMM_MeredithXtra.archive in your mod folder, will have been installed with AMM. Worked fine for me after losing that.
